Windows.Services.Store 名前空間

現在のアプリの Microsoft Store 関連データにアクセスして管理するために使用できる型とメンバーを提供します。 たとえば、この名前空間を使用して、現在のアプリの Microsoft Store 登録情報とライセンス情報を取得したり、アプリによって提供されている現在のアプリまたは製品を購入したり、アプリのパッケージ更新プログラムをダウンロードしてインストールしたりできます。

注意

この名前空間はバージョン 1607 Windows 10で導入され、Windows 10 Anniversary Edition (10.0;Visual Studio のビルド 14393) 以降のリリース。 プロジェクトが以前のバージョンのWindows 10を対象とする場合は、Windows.Services.Store 名前空間ではなく Windows.ApplicationModel.Store 名前空間を使用する必要があります。 詳しくは、「アプリ内購入と試用版」をご覧ください。

クラス

StoreAcquireLicenseResult

現在のアプリのダウンロード可能コンテンツ (DLC) アドオン パッケージのライセンスを取得するための要求の応答データを提供します。

StoreAppLicense

アプリによって提供される製品のライセンスを含む、現在のアプリのライセンス情報を提供します。

StoreAvailability

購入できる製品 SKU の特定のインスタンスを表します。

StoreCanAcquireLicenseResult

ダウンロード可能コンテンツ (DLC) アドオン パッケージのライセンスを取得できるかどうかを判断するための要求の応答データを提供します。

StoreCollectionData

ユーザーが使用する権利を持つ製品 SKU の追加データを提供します。

StoreConsumableResult

現在のアプリのコンシューマブル アドオンを含む要求の応答データを提供します。

StoreContext

現在のアプリの Microsoft Store 関連データにアクセスして管理するために使用できるメンバーを提供します。 たとえば、このクラスのメンバーを使用して、現在のアプリの Microsoft Store 登録情報とライセンス情報を取得したり、アプリによって提供されている現在のアプリまたは製品を購入したり、アプリのパッケージ更新プログラムをダウンロードしてインストールしたりできます。

デスクトップ アプリでは、UI を表示する方法でこのクラスのインスタンスを使用する前に、オブジェクトを所有者のウィンドウ ハンドルに関連付ける必要があります。 詳細とコード例については、「 CoreWindow に依存する WinRT UI オブジェクトを表示する」を参照してください。

StoreImage

Windows ストアの製品一覧に関連付けられているイメージを表します。

StoreLicense

現在のアプリに関連付けられている永続的なアドオンのライセンス情報を提供します。

StorePackageInstallOptions

RequestDownloadAndInstallStorePackagesAsync メソッドを使用して、現在のアプリのダウンロード可能なコンテンツ (DLC) パッケージをダウンロードしてインストールするときに指定できるオプションを表します。

StorePackageLicense

現在のアプリのダウンロード可能なコンテンツ (DLC) パッケージのライセンス情報を提供します。

StorePackageUpdate

Microsoft Store からダウンロードできる更新プログラムがある現在のアプリのパッケージに関する情報を提供します。

StorePackageUpdateResult

現在のアプリのパッケージをダウンロードしてインストールする要求の応答データを提供します。

StorePrice

Microsoft Store の製品一覧の価格情報が含まれています。

StoreProduct

Microsoft Store で使用できる製品を表します。

StoreProductOptions

GetStoreProductsAsync メソッドで使用して、現在のアプリに関連付けられている指定された製品の情報を取得できるフィルター文字列のコレクションが含まれています。

StoreProductPagedQueryResult

現在のアプリ内から購入できる製品に関する詳細を取得するための、ページングされた要求の応答データを提供します。

StoreProductQueryResult

現在のアプリ内から購入できる製品に関する詳細を取得するための要求の応答データを提供します。

StoreProductResult

現在のアプリに関する詳細を取得する要求の応答データを提供します。

StorePurchaseProperties

購入時にユーザーに表示する製品名など、製品の購入要求に渡すことができる追加の詳細が含まれます。

StorePurchaseResult

アプリによって提供されるアプリまたは製品を購入する要求の応答データを提供します。

StoreQueueItem

現在のアプリのダウンロードおよびインストール キューにある新しいパッケージまたは更新されたパッケージに関する情報を表します。

StoreQueueItemCompletedEventArgs

StoreQueueItem クラスの Completed イベントのデータを提供します。

StoreQueueItemStatus

現在のアプリのダウンロードおよびインストール キューにある新しいパッケージまたは更新されたパッケージの状態情報を提供します。

StoreRateAndReviewResult

製品の評価とレビューを行う要求の応答データを提供します。

StoreRequestHelper

Windows SDK で使用できる対応する API がまだない操作に対して、Microsoft Store に要求を送信するために使用できるヘルパー メソッドを提供します。

StoreSendRequestResult

Microsoft Store に送信される要求の応答データを提供します。

StoreSku

Microsoft Store の製品の在庫保管単位 (SKU) に関する情報を提供します。

StoreSubscriptionInfo

定期的な課金があるサブスクリプションを表す製品 SKU のサブスクリプション情報を提供します。

StoreUninstallStorePackageResult

現在のアプリのパッケージをアンインストールする要求の応答データを提供します。

StoreVideo

Microsoft Store の製品一覧に関連付けられているビデオを表します。

構造体

StorePackageUpdateStatus

ダウンロードまたはインストール要求に関連付けられているパッケージの状態情報を提供します。

列挙型

StoreCanLicenseStatus

ダウンロード可能コンテンツ (DLC) アドオン パッケージのライセンス状態を表す値を定義します。

StoreConsumableStatus

コンシューマブル アドオンに関連する要求の状態を表す値を定義します。

StoreDurationUnit

サブスクリプションの試用期間または請求期間の単位を表す値を定義します。

StorePackageUpdateState

パッケージのダウンロードまたはインストール要求の状態を表す値を定義します。

StorePurchaseStatus

アプリまたはアドオンを購入する要求の状態を表す値を定義します。

StoreQueueItemExtendedState

現在のアプリのダウンロードおよびインストール キューにある新規または更新されたパッケージの拡張状態情報を表す値を定義します。

StoreQueueItemKind

ダウンロードおよびインストール キュー内の現在のパッケージに対して実行される操作を記述する値を定義します。

StoreQueueItemState

現在のアプリのダウンロードおよびインストール キューにある新しいパッケージまたは更新されたパッケージの状態を指定する値を定義します。

StoreRateAndReviewStatus

製品のレートとレビュー要求の結果の状態を取得します。

StoreUninstallStorePackageStatus

パッケージアンインストール要求の状態を表す値を定義します。

注釈

StoreContext クラスは、Windows.Services.Store 名前空間へのメインエントリ ポイントです。 このクラスのメンバーを使用して、現在のアプリの Microsoft Store 登録情報とライセンス情報の取得、アプリによって提供されている現在のアプリまたはアドオンの購入、アプリのパッケージ更新プログラムのダウンロードとインストールなどのタスクを実行します。 この名前空間の他のクラスと型は、アプリのアドオン、アプリとそのアドオンのライセンス、アプリの Microsoft Store 登録情報などの項目を表します。

こちらもご覧ください